As COVID-19 hits the African continent with full force, the more than one million women, children, and families we serve need us more than ever. m2m's frontline staff – the amazing women living with HIV m2m employs as Mentor Mothers across 10 countries – are bolstering sub-Saharan Africa’s under-resourced health systems while supporting their clients to stay healthy and safe in the face of two pandemics—COVID-19 and HIV. The challenge usually takes place in one of the African countries where m2m work, but this year due to travel restrictions caused by COVID-19, for the first time ever, the cycle will be virtual and open to everyone.
Since m2m was founded in 2001 over 11 million women and children under the age of two have been reached with direct services, and over 11,000 jobs have been created for women living with HIV. m2m's dream is of a world where no mother dies of AIDS and no baby is born with HIV.
